_corFlags | System.Reflection.PortableExecutable.ManagedPEBuilder | private |
_debugDirectoryBuilderOpt | System.Reflection.PortableExecutable.ManagedPEBuilder | private |
_entryPointOpt | System.Reflection.PortableExecutable.ManagedPEBuilder | private |
_ilStream | System.Reflection.PortableExecutable.ManagedPEBuilder | private |
_lazyChecksum | System.Reflection.PortableExecutable.PEBuilder | private |
_lazyEntryPointAddress | System.Reflection.PortableExecutable.ManagedPEBuilder | private |
_lazySections | System.Reflection.PortableExecutable.PEBuilder | private |
_lazyStrongNameSignature | System.Reflection.PortableExecutable.ManagedPEBuilder | private |
_managedResourcesOpt | System.Reflection.PortableExecutable.ManagedPEBuilder | private |
_mappedFieldDataOpt | System.Reflection.PortableExecutable.ManagedPEBuilder | private |
_metadataRootBuilder | System.Reflection.PortableExecutable.ManagedPEBuilder | private |
_nativeResourcesOpt | System.Reflection.PortableExecutable.ManagedPEBuilder | private |
_peDirectoriesBuilder | System.Reflection.PortableExecutable.ManagedPEBuilder | private |
_strongNameSignatureSize | System.Reflection.PortableExecutable.ManagedPEBuilder | private |
AggregateChecksum(uint checksum, ushort value) | System.Reflection.PortableExecutable.PEBuilder | inlineprivatestatic |
CalculateChecksum(BlobBuilder peImage, Blob checksumFixup) | System.Reflection.PortableExecutable.PEBuilder | inlinepackagestatic |
CalculateChecksum(IEnumerable< Blob > blobs) | System.Reflection.PortableExecutable.PEBuilder | inlineprivatestatic |
CreateDefaultDebugDirectoryBuilder() | System.Reflection.PortableExecutable.ManagedPEBuilder | inlineprivate |
CreateSections() | System.Reflection.PortableExecutable.ManagedPEBuilder | inlineprotected |
DosHeaderSize | System.Reflection.PortableExecutable.PEBuilder | packagestatic |
GetContentToChecksum(BlobBuilder peImage, Blob checksumFixup) | System.Reflection.PortableExecutable.PEBuilder | inlinepackagestatic |
GetContentToSign(BlobBuilder peImage, int peHeadersSize, int peHeaderAlignment, Blob strongNameSignatureFixup) | System.Reflection.PortableExecutable.PEBuilder | inlinepackagestatic |
GetDirectories() | System.Reflection.PortableExecutable.ManagedPEBuilder | inlinepackage |
GetPrefixBlob(Blob container, Blob blob) | System.Reflection.PortableExecutable.PEBuilder | inlinepackagestatic |
GetSections() | System.Reflection.PortableExecutable.PEBuilder | inlineprotected |
GetSuffixBlob(Blob container, Blob blob) | System.Reflection.PortableExecutable.PEBuilder | inlinepackagestatic |
Header | System.Reflection.PortableExecutable.PEBuilder | |
IdProvider | System.Reflection.PortableExecutable.PEBuilder | |
IndexOfSection(ImmutableArray< SerializedSection > sections, SectionCharacteristics characteristics) | System.Reflection.PortableExecutable.PEBuilder | inlineprivatestatic |
IsDeterministic | System.Reflection.PortableExecutable.PEBuilder | |
ManagedPEBuilder(PEHeaderBuilder header, MetadataRootBuilder metadataRootBuilder, BlobBuilder ilStream, BlobBuilder? mappedFieldData=null, BlobBuilder? managedResources=null, ResourceSectionBuilder? nativeResources=null, DebugDirectoryBuilder? debugDirectoryBuilder=null, int strongNameSignatureSize=128, MethodDefinitionHandle entryPoint=default(MethodDefinitionHandle), CorFlags flags=CorFlags.ILOnly, Func< IEnumerable< Blob >, BlobContentId >? deterministicIdProvider=null) | System.Reflection.PortableExecutable.ManagedPEBuilder | inline |
ManagedResourcesDataAlignment | System.Reflection.PortableExecutable.ManagedPEBuilder | static |
MappedFieldDataAlignment | System.Reflection.PortableExecutable.ManagedPEBuilder | static |
PEBuilder(PEHeaderBuilder header, Func< IEnumerable< Blob >, BlobContentId >? deterministicIdProvider) | System.Reflection.PortableExecutable.PEBuilder | inlineprotected |
s_dosHeader | System.Reflection.PortableExecutable.PEBuilder | privatestatic |
Serialize(BlobBuilder builder) | System.Reflection.PortableExecutable.PEBuilder | inline |
SerializeRelocationSection(SectionLocation location) | System.Reflection.PortableExecutable.ManagedPEBuilder | inlineprivate |
SerializeResourceSection(SectionLocation location) | System.Reflection.PortableExecutable.ManagedPEBuilder | inlineprivate |
SerializeSection(string name, SectionLocation location) | System.Reflection.PortableExecutable.ManagedPEBuilder | inlineprotected |
SerializeSections() | System.Reflection.PortableExecutable.PEBuilder | inlineprivate |
SerializeTextSection(SectionLocation location) | System.Reflection.PortableExecutable.ManagedPEBuilder | inlineprivate |
Sign(BlobBuilder peImage, Func< IEnumerable< Blob >, byte[]> signatureProvider) | System.Reflection.PortableExecutable.ManagedPEBuilder | inline |
System::Reflection::PortableExecutable::PEBuilder.Sign(BlobBuilder peImage, Blob strongNameSignatureFixup, Func< IEnumerable< Blob >, byte[]> signatureProvider) | System.Reflection.PortableExecutable.PEBuilder | inlinepackage |
SumRawDataSizes(ImmutableArray< SerializedSection > sections, SectionCharacteristics characteristics) | System.Reflection.PortableExecutable.PEBuilder | inlineprivatestatic |
WriteCoffHeader(BlobBuilder builder, ImmutableArray< SerializedSection > sections, out Blob stampFixup) | System.Reflection.PortableExecutable.PEBuilder | inlineprivate |
WritePEHeader(BlobBuilder builder, PEDirectoriesBuilder directories, ImmutableArray< SerializedSection > sections) | System.Reflection.PortableExecutable.PEBuilder | inlineprivate |
WritePESignature(BlobBuilder builder) | System.Reflection.PortableExecutable.PEBuilder | inlineprivate |
WriteRelocationSection(BlobBuilder builder, Machine machine, int entryPointAddress) | System.Reflection.PortableExecutable.ManagedPEBuilder | inlineprivatestatic |
WriteSectionHeader(BlobBuilder builder, SerializedSection serializedSection) | System.Reflection.PortableExecutable.PEBuilder | inlineprivatestatic |
WriteSectionHeaders(BlobBuilder builder, ImmutableArray< SerializedSection > serializedSections) | System.Reflection.PortableExecutable.PEBuilder | inlineprivate |